Phan Văn Hùm (9 April 1902 – 1946) was a Vietnamese Trotskyist who took part in the Fourth International in 1922.

He spent three years in Poulo Condore jail from 1939–1942. He was killed by the Viet Minh in the days following the Japanese surrender in Vietnam at the end of World War II. His fellow Trotskyites Tạ Thu Thâu and Phan Văn Chánh met the same fate.
